Batteries

The most important element of any key fob is the battery. It's the one that allows you to unlock your car and start it. The battery can eventually become too fragile and must be replaced.

The life expectancy of your Porsche 911 turbo s key key fob battery depends on a number of variables. This includes how frequently you use it as well as the place you live. The majority of people should expect to get between three to four years out of a new battery.

If the battery in your Porsche key fob begins to fail, you could observe that the buttons on the remote do not perform as well. This indicates that your key fob's battery needs to be replaced.

It could also be that your keys aren't working in any way. If your keys aren't working and you're not sure why, you might need a new battery.

To replace the battery, simply take your key fob from your door lock and flip it to the back. Press the release button at the bottom of the key, and then pull it away from the rest of the key to take it off. it.

After your key fob has been removed, carefully pull out the old CR 2032 3 Volt Lithium battery by moving the plastic that holds the clip back. After that, place the new CR20323 Volt Lithium battery making sure that they face the right way.

After the batteries have been installed, you're able to begin testing them on your car. If you're not able to unlock your doors, open the trunk, or shut off the panic alarm on your Porsche key fob, it's most likely time for a new battery.
